The Agilent Keysight 8991A Peak Power Analyzer provides complete and accurate characterization of complex pulsed RF and microwave signals. It features two dedicated sensor channels and two oscilloscope/video channels, allowing for the simultaneous measurement of modulating signals and detector power envelopes.

Frequency and Power Measurement Specifications
| Parameter | Value |
|---|---|
| Frequency Range | 50 MHz to 40 GHz (sensor dependent) |
| Power Measurement Range | -32 to +20 dBm (sensor dependent) |
| Dynamic Range | 52 dB (sensor dependent) |
| Minimum Pulse Width | 20 ns |
| Rise Time | <5 ns (with 84812A/13A/14A sensors) |
Sensor Compatibility and Inputs
| Parameter | Value |
|---|---|
| Number of Channels | 4 (2 sensor channels, 2 oscilloscope/video channels) |
| Sensor Input Channels | Ch 1 and Ch 4 |
| Oscilloscope/Video Channels | Ch 2 and Ch 3 |
| Compatible Sensor Models | Agilent 84812A, 84813A, 84814A, 84815A |
| Internal Calibrator Frequency | 1.00 GHz |
| Internal Calibrator Power Level | 10.0 mW (+10 dBm) |
| Internal Calibrator Connector | Type-N (female) on front panel |
| Calibrator Power Uncertainty | ±1.5% (at 10 mW) |
| Video Channel Bandwidth | 100 MHz (Channels 2 and 3) |
| Video Channel Input Impedance | 1 MOhm (nominal) |
